The inaugural 404 Day Kickoff brought the community together to honor the people, places, and powerful voices that define Atlanta. Hosted by the Mayor’s Office of Film, Entertainment & Nightlife in collaboration with ATL Direct, this event was a love letter to the culture—raw, real, and radiant.
A Celebration of Legacy and Love
From West End to Edgewood, from Bankhead to Buckhead, 404 isn’t just an area code—it’s a bond. On 404 Day, Atlanta came out in full force to honor that bond with live music, food, fashion, vendors, and moments that reminded us all why Atlanta leads with heart.
“Everything that comes from this city is legendary,” one participant said, eyes beaming with pride. “We’re out here giving back, celebrating, passing the love around.”
In a city where music speaks louder than words and style is stitched into every sidewalk, 404 Day is a moment to pause and recognize what we’ve built—and who we’ve become.
Honoring the Culture That Built Atlanta
Atlanta is the birthplace of movements. It’s the soundtrack of generations. It’s the frontline of innovation and the keeper of tradition.
This year’s 404 Day also honored hometown heroes like Yung Joc, who continue to shape the city’s creative identity. Artists, performers, community leaders, and everyday Atlantans showed up to celebrate—not just what the city is, but what it’s becoming.
With support from local radio stations, community organizations, and City departments, the celebration was both a grassroots gathering and an official recognition of the magic that lives in Atlanta’s streets.
